Small Club, Big History

Yorkshire Terriers were one of the first gay-friendly teams to be founded in the UK, back in 1997 and were a founder member of the GFSN (Gay Football Supporters Network) National League at the start of the 2002/3 season.



Since then, we've won the league, national cup, numerous small-sided competitions and have been a fixture in the top flight as the GFSN League has expanded over the years.
